On another note, for those that don't know why Aberdeen fans call him Bebo: ABERDEEN footballer Chris Maguire is being investigated after a vitriolic outburst against Rangers appeared on a website. The Pittodrie youngster has been hauled in front of club chiefs after comments about the Ibrox side appeared on his Bebo internet page. The message on Maguire's site branded Rangers "scum", called Barry Ferguson a p**** and Alan Hutton a d***. Maguire allegedly vowed to "take out" Rangers captain Ferguson. The 18-year-old striker also threatened the same treatment for Gers' and Scotland defender Hutton. Aberdeen strenuously deny Maguire had any knowledge of these posts on his web page and say hackers are responsible. They say the player claims someone had used his Bebo account. The threats were made before the fiery clash between the sides at Pittodrie last Sunday during which he angrily clashed with Ferguson. A message posted on a Rangers-supporting pal's Bebo page on December 20 from Maguire's page read: "We will beat you scum on Sunday. I'll take out that wee p**** Barry Ferguson and that d*** Hutton. Haha." Maguire and Ferguson clashed during the hotly-contested draw at Pittodrie three days later. The Scotland captain grabbed the Dons' player by the throat after appearing to have been fouled by the youngster. However, the startled Aberdeen forward didn't live up to his pre-match boasts and refused to react to Ferguson, who escaped punishment for his retaliation. David Edgar of the Rangers Supporters' Trust described Maguire's comments as sad. He said: "Who exactly is Chris Maguire to say anything about our national team captain and s8million-rated right-back? "What has he achieved in the game? When he has some medals he can come back and talk to us. "Let's face it though, he will probably be playing for East Fife and working in Asda in three years. "It's what you'd expect from an Aberdeen player. Their problem has always been that they are more obsessed with us than they are with themselves." A Pittodrie spokesman said: "Chris maintains the comments were left by someone else who must have used his Bebo account. "He is aware any such comments are totally unacceptable and that Aberdeen FC will not accept them." Maguire is rated one of the most promising young players in Scotland, having made his debut for Aberdeen aged 17. He has since become a regular in the side having made 27 appearances, scoring one goal in the process. It is also alleged that three weeks ago comments from Maguire's page made reference to Celtic and read: "Alrite m8, Wot s*** is that u have got on ure page??? "And Alan Hutton. He is a p**** and is s****. "There's only 1 team in scotland m8 and we all know who that is .. champions again this year ..." SFA chiefs last night admitted the matter is likely to be referred to their general purposes committee with Maguire being investigated for bringing the game into disrepute.
